Are R programmers in demand?

R programmers, including self-employed data analysts skilled in R programming, are in demand due to the growing need for data analysis and statistical modeling across industries. Proficiency in R, along with skills in data visualization and machine learning, increases job opportunities in analytics, research, and consulting roles.

Can a self employed data analyst R programming be self-employed?

A self-employed data analyst skilled in R programming can work independently, offering services such as data analysis, visualization, and reporting to clients. Being self-employed requires managing your own schedule, acquiring clients, and possibly obtaining relevant certifications or a portfolio to demonstrate expertise.

Do data analysts use R programming?

Data analysts often use R programming as it provides powerful tools for data manipulation, statistical analysis, and visualization. R is widely adopted in the field for its extensive package ecosystem and open-source nature, making it a valuable skill for data analysis roles.

Position Purpose:
We are seeking a highly analytical and detail-oriented Data Analyst to support data-driven decision-making across the organization. This role will be responsible for transforming raw data into actionable insights, developing dashboards and reports, and partnering cross-functionally to improve operational and financial performance. The ideal candidate combines strong technical skills with business acumen and the ability to clearly communicate findings to senior leadership. This is an on-site role.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
Data Analysis amp; Reporting
  • Collect, validate, and analyze large datasets from multiple sources including ERP, CRM, and operational systems.
  • Develop dashboards and recurring reports using BI tools (e.g., Power BI, Tableau, Looker) to support Finance and cross-functional leadership.
  • Build and maintain queries and data models to support reporting accuracy, consistency, and scalability.
Insights amp; Decision Support
  • Identify trends, anomalies, and performance drivers; translate findings into clear, actionable recommendations for senior leadership.
  • Partner with Finance, Operations, Sales, and Executive Leadership to define KPIs, metrics, and reporting frameworks.
  • Support forecasting and scenario modeling through advanced analytics to inform strategic and operational decisions.
Process Improvement amp; Data Governance
  • Automate manual reporting processes to improve efficiency, reduce error risk, and free capacity for higher-value analysis.
  • Ensure data integrity, governance, and documentation standards are maintained across all reporting outputs.
